If you're seeking a buggy that can handle the tough terrain, then an all-terrain pushchair is the best choice. These buggies are designed to provide smooth rides on bumpy surfaces, and they can also take on a rocky kerb. In addition, they are simple to maneuver and fold up when not in use.

It is crucial to take into account the suspension and tyres before selecting an all-terrain vehicle. A good all-terrain vehicle should have tyres filled with air that will provide the ride more comfort. However, these tyres may be susceptible to punctures and you'll need to bring an repair kit. Foam-filled tyres are another alternative. They are more durable, but do not provide as much cushioning.

A quality all-terrain buggy should feature a front wheel that can be changed to the swivel position for better maneuverability indoors and in towns. This will let you effortlessly navigate around obstacles and narrow roads. It is also important to check the size of the buggy when folded, as it must be small enough to fit in a small car boot.

The Urban Glide 2 is a stylish pushchair which is great for taking on tough terrain. MFM reviewer Kath stated that it "navigates over rough terrain cobbles, grass, and grass effortlessly, and is able to climb and descend kerbs". It comes with 16" air-filled wheels at the rear, and a lockable front wheel to ensure stable jogging. It also has a good suspension and a user-friendly handbrake that twists.

This all-terrain stroller has a large, padded seat with a 5-point harness that can be adjusted to various heights. It offers maximum comfort. It can be used with a carrycot or car seat and comes with a handy tray for the parent. A large shopping basket, as well as a spacious storage pocket underneath the seat are also included. It also has an enormous, hood-mounted cup holder, as well as LED lights for visibility that are extremely useful for walking or running in low light conditions.

Another all-terrain pram is the Mountain Buggy Duet, which has a variety of features to suit active families. The front swivel wheel is able to be locked to provide greater control over rough terrain, and the massive 16" air-filled wheels offer superb grip on any terrain. It also features a twist handbrake, reflective rims, and wheels and a canopy.
